Heet is a district located in the Al Anbar Governorate of western Iraq. Situated approximately 160 kilometers west of Baghdad, Heet occupies a strategic position along the Euphrates River, which flows through the heart of the district. The town of Heet serves as the administrative center and is historically significant as one of the oldest continuously inhabited settlements in the region, with archaeological evidence dating back thousands of years. The district covers an area of approximately 3,500 square kilometers and has an estimated population of around 150,000 people, primarily engaged in agriculture, trade, and local governance. Heet is administratively divided into several sub-districts and numerous villages that spread across its territory, which includes both fertile river valleys and arid desert landscapes. The district's location along major transportation routes has made it an important economic and cultural crossroads throughout history.
